Abstract
Background Alendronate is used to treat Paget's bone disease, glucocorticoid-induced osteoporosis, and postmenopausal osteoporosis because it suppresses osteoclast activity to stop bone resorption. Case report We present an exceptional case of esophagitis caused by alendronate. Blood tests and other data were normal when the patient was taken to the hospital, but an endoscopic examination revealed significant esophageal redness, erosion, and ulceration, along with pseudomembrane. The patient was given medicine after receiving a diagnosis of alendronate pill-induced esophagitis based on the pathological findings. Conclusion This case report is a timely reminder of the importance of thorough pharmacovigilance, patient education, and smart therapeutic decision-making in the context of alendronate use. To properly treat and prevent problems with the esophagus caused by alendronate, additional research is required.

Abstract
BACKGROUND Alendronate-induced esophagitis is a rare form of pill esophagitis. With the wide application of alendronate, the incidence of adverse events affecting the esophagus has increased; however, some endoscopists have a relatively insufficient understanding of the disease and cannot identify the cause in time.
CASE SUMMARY A woman presented with chest pain and she was diagnosed with alendronate-associated pill esophagitis by the medical history and typical endoscopic findings, thus removing the cause and avoiding further esophageal injury.
CONCLUSION Alendronate-associated pill esophagitis relies on prevention and timely diagnosis. A detailed medical history, typical endoscopic manifestations, and pathological features are helpful for early diagnosis.

Abstract
UNLABELLED Few studies have explored the association of oral bisphosphonate exposure and gastrointestinal cancer within Asian populations. In this study, we investigated 45,397 Korean women from the nationwide population-based cohort from 2002 to 2013. Oral bisphosphonate exposure did not appear to be associated with elevated or reduced risk for gastrointestinal cancer. INTRODUCTION While several studies suggested increased risk in upper gastrointestinal (GI) cancer or reduced risk in colorectal cancer upon bisphosphonate exposure, the association is less explored within Asian populations. We investigated the effect of oral bisphosphonate exposure on the risk of GI cancers within a nationwide population-based cohort. METHODS This study used two separate cohorts. The first cohort included 45,397 women aged 60 years or older from the National Health Insurance Service-Health Screening Cohort during 2002-2013. Participants were classified into bisphosphonate users and non-users based on drug exposure during 2002-2007, and followed-up from the index date of January 1, 2008. The second cohort included 25,665 newly diagnosed osteoporosis patients who started taking oral bisphosphonate during 2003-2008. After 4 years of drug exposure period, patients were separated into quartiles based on cumulative oral bisphosphonate exposure. Participants were followed-up until December 31, 2013 for GI cancer, stomach cancer, and colorectal cancer. Cox proportional hazard regression models were used to assess the hazard ratios (HRs) and 95% confidence intervals (CIs) for the cancer risks. RESULTS Compared to bisphosphonate non-users, no significant risk difference was observed among bisphosphonate users on GI (HR 1.06; 95% CI 0.87-1.28), stomach (HR 1.11; 95% CI 0.85-1.47) and colorectal cancers (HR 1.04; 95% CI 0.79-1.37). Among bisphosphonate users, increasing doses of bisphosphonate exposure was not associated with elevated or reduced risk for GI cancer (p for trend 0.573). CONCLUSION Oral bisphosphonate use did not appear to be associated with elevated or reduced risk for GI cancers.

Abstract
A variety of clinically significant conditions can affect both the esophagus and the skin. Esophageal and cutaneous manifestations may directly reflect the underlying disease process, as in infections such as herpes simplex virus, bullous diseases such as epidermolysis bullosa and mucous membrane pemphigoid, connective tissue diseases such as systemic sclerosis, and inflammatory diseases such as lichen planus. Alternatively, esophageal and cutaneous findings may result from conditions that are closely associated with and potentially pathognomonic for but distinct from the underlying disease process, as in genetic diseases such as Cowden syndrome or paraneoplastic syndromes such as acrokeratosis paraneoplastica. Other diseases such as Crohn disease may have cutaneous manifestations that directly reflect the same underlying inflammatory process that affects the gastrointestinal tract or cutaneous manifestations that represent reactive or associated conditions distinct from the underlying inflammatory process. The cutaneous manifestations of disease may precede, coincide with, or follow the esophageal manifestations of disease. The authors present the characteristic clinical features and imaging findings associated with common and uncommon conditions that have esophageal and cutaneous manifestations. Each condition is presented with a brief overview, discussion of salient clinical and cutaneous manifestations, and description of the typical esophageal imaging findings, with particular attention to implications for diagnosis, prognosis, and treatment. Recognition of potential associations between cutaneous lesions and esophageal imaging findings is important for establishing a specific diagnosis or generating a meaningful differential diagnosis.

Abstract
Bisphosphonate, tetracycline and spironolactone use has been shown to increase gastro-oesophageal inflammation, an accepted risk factor for cancer. However, evidence of the effect of these medications on gastro-oesophageal cancer risk are mixed or missing entirely. Therefore, we conducted a nested case-control study using the Primary Care Clinical Information Unit Research (PCCIUR) database from Scotland. Cases with oesophageal or gastric cancer between 1999 and 2011 were matched to up to five controls based on age, gender, year of diagnosis and general practice. Medication use was ascertained using electronic prescribing records. Conditional logistic regression was used to calculate odds ratios (ORs) for the association between medication use and cancer risk after adjustment for comorbidities and other medication use. A similar proportion of gastro-oesophageal cancer cases received bisphosphonates (3.9% vs. 3.5%), tetracycline (6.0% vs. 6.0%) and spironolactone (1.4% vs. 1.1%) compared with the controls. The adjusted ORs for the association between gastro-oesophageal cancer and bisphosphonates, tetracycline and spironolactone were 1.05 (95% CI: 0.85, 1.31), 0.99 (95% CI: 0.84, 1.17) and 1.04 (95% CI: 0.73, 1.49). Further analysis revealed bisphosphonates were associated with increased oesophageal cancer risk (1.34, 95% CI: 1.03, 1.74) but reduced gastric cancer risk (0.71, 95% CI: 0.49, 1.03), although there was no obvious dose-response relationship. Overall, there is little evidence that the use of bisphosphonate, tetracycline or spironolactone is associated with increased risk of gastro-oesophageal cancer. Our findings should reassure GPs and patients that these widely-used medications are safe with respect to gastro-oesophageal cancer risk.

Abstract
BACKGROUND Controversy still exists regarding whether alendronate (ALN) use increases the risk of esophageal cancer or breast cancer. METHODS This paper explores the possible association between the use of oral ALN in osteoporosis patients and subsequent cancer risk using the National Health Insurance (NHI) system database of Taiwan with a Cox proportional-hazard regression analysis. The exposure cohort contained 5,624 osteoporosis patients used ALN and randomly frequency-matched by age and gender of 3 osteoporosis patients without any kind of anti-osteoporosis drugs in the same period. RESULTS For a dose ≥ 1.0 g/year, the risk of developing overall cancer was significantly higher (hazard ratio: 1.69, 95% confidence ratio: 1.39-2.04) than in osteoporosis patients without any anti-osteoporosis drugs. The risks for developing liver, lung, and prostate cancers and lymphoma were also significantly higher than in the control group. CONCLUSIONS This population-based retrospective cohort study did not find a relationship between ALN use and either esophageal or breast cancer, but unexpectedly discovered that use of ALN with dose ≥ 1.0 g/year significantly increased risks of overall cancer incidence, as well as liver, lung, and prostate cancers and lymphoma. Further large population-based unbiased studies to enforce our findings are required before any confirmatory conclusion can be made.

Abstract
Drugs in the bisphosphonate class are the most commonly prescribed therapeutic agents for the treatment of osteoporosis. Prospective, randomized, placebo-controlled clinical trials have demonstrated efficacy in reducing fracture risk, with favourable safety profiles, in women with postmenopausal osteoporosis. However, long-term use in clinical practice has been associated with reports of undesirable events not previously recognized. These have included gastrointestinal intolerance, osteonecrosis of the jaw, atypical femur fractures, oesophageal cancer, atrial fibrillation and chronic musculoskeletal pain. Physicians must be alert to newly recognized safety concerns, understand the level of evidence supporting them and be able to effectively communicate the balance of expected benefit and potential risk to patients. Usually, post-marketing adverse events are first presented as case reports or observational studies with variable levels of supporting evidence for plausibility, pathophysiology and causality. Widespread coverage in the news media, which can be alarming to patients and their physicians, may not present a balanced view of the proven benefits, the uncertain risks of therapy and the relative magnitude of these events. There may be confusion about the risks associated with bisphosphonate use for the treatment of osteoporosis versus treatment of other conditions, such as cancer, which typically involves a very different patient population and different doses or frequency of drug administration. Often reports of possible adverse events do not provide information on the number of patients exposed to the drug in proportion to the reported adverse event, or do not describe the incidence of the adverse event in a comparator population not exposed to the drug. Gastrointestinal intolerance with oral bisphosphonates, and hypocalcaemia, acute phase reactions and renal toxicity with intravenous bisphosphonates are characterized by biological plausibility and demonstration of causality. Safety concerns with uncertain biological plausibility and unproven causality include osteonecrosis of the jaw, atypical femur fractures, oesophageal cancer and ocular inflammation. Suspected concerns that are unlikely to be causally related include atrial fibrillation and hepatotoxicity. When making the decision to use a bisphosphonate for the treatment of osteoporosis, the balance between benefit and potential risks according to clinical circumstances of each patient should be considered.

Abstract
CONTEXT Use of oral bisphosphonates has increased dramatically in the United States and elsewhere. Esophagitis is a known adverse effect of bisphosphonate use, and recent reports suggest a link between bisphosphonate use and esophageal cancer, but this has not been robustly investigated. OBJECTIVE To investigate the association between bisphosphonate use and esophageal cancer. DESIGN, SETTING, AND PARTICIPANTS Data were extracted from the UK General Practice Research Database to compare the incidence of esophageal and gastric cancer in a cohort of patients treated with oral bisphosphonates between January 1996 and December 2006 with incidence in a control cohort. Cancers were identified from relevant Read/Oxford Medical Information System codes in the patient's clinical files. Cox proportional hazards modeling was used to calculate hazard ratios and 95% confidence intervals for risk of esophageal and gastric cancer in bisphosphonate users compared with nonusers, with adjustment for potential confounders. MAIN OUTCOME MEASURE Hazard ratio for the risk of esophageal and gastric cancer in the bisphosphonate users compared with the bisphosphonate nonusers. RESULTS Mean follow-up time was 4.5 and 4.4 years in the bisphosphonate and control cohorts, respectively. Excluding patients with less than 6 months' follow-up, there were 41 826 members in each cohort (81% women; mean age, 70.0 (SD, 11.4) years). One hundred sixteen esophageal or gastric cancers (79 esophageal) occurred in the bisphosphonate cohort and 115 (72 esophageal) in the control cohort. The incidence of esophageal and gastric cancer combined was 0.7 per 1000 person-years of risk in both the bisphosphonate and control cohorts; the incidence of esophageal cancer alone in the bisphosphonate and control cohorts was 0.48 and 0.44 per 1000 person-years of risk, respectively. There was no difference in risk of esophageal and gastric cancer combined between the cohorts for any bisphosphonate use (adjusted hazard ratio, 0.96 [95% confidence interval, 0.74-1.25]) or risk of esophageal cancer only (adjusted hazard ratio, 1.07 [95% confidence interval, 0.77-1.49]). There also was no difference in risk of esophageal or gastric cancer by duration of bisphosphonate intake. CONCLUSION Among patients in the UK General Practice Research Database, the use of oral bisphosphonates was not significantly associated with incident esophageal or gastric cancer.

Abstract
Alendronic acid, a frequently applied compound for the treatment of different forms of diseases of bone metabolism, is a strong acid with a high solubility in water. In connection with the oral administration this exhibits a potential health risk for the upper gastrointestinal tract. The in vitro release of tablets containing alendronic acid of different brands (Stada, ratiopharm, interpharm, Fosamax) was determined by dissolution tests for the time period required for oral intake. The effect of rotation speed, temperature, and solvent volume on the release rate of alendronic acid was determined for the used dissolution apparatus. Analysis of alendronic acid was performed by a validated HPLC method. The highest rate of release was found for the original brand. The dissolution rate of the generic formulations was significantly lower in the early stage of dissolution. Over the complete range of dissolution, more than 85% of the claimed amount was dissolved within 4 min. Dissolution profiles were compared by calculation of the similarity factor f(2) showing equal products with the exception of one generic product, whose dissolution rate was lower.

Abstract
Upper gastrointestinal tract mucosal irritations, such as esophagitis, have been reported as rare adverse events due to a variety of aminobisphosphonates, including alendronate sodium, which have been widely used to treat osteoporosis. Although the pathogenesis of aminobisphosphonate-induced esophageal mucosal irritation has not been clearly understood, direct chemical esophageal irritation with prolonged local mucosal exposure to the drug with gastric contents might be the most plausible mechanism according to the previously reported literature. Here we report a young adult man with severe ulcerative esophagitis due to alendronate who demonstrated a strongly positive result on a drug lymphocyte stimulation test against alendronate. This case report provides the new concept that T-cell mediated delayed hypersensitivity to the drug may be involved in the pathogenesis of alendronate-induced esophagitis.

Abstract
Oral daily bisphosphonates carry a potential for gastrointestinal (GI) adverse events, which has been partly addressed by introducing once-weekly regimens. Nevertheless, the need to follow inconvenient dosing instructions every week could still hinder long-term compliance and therapeutic outcome. In addition, survey data indicates that many patients would prefer a once-monthly rather than once-weekly bisphosphonate dosing regimen. Ibandronate is a potent, nitrogen-containing bisphosphonate specifically developed for less frequent administration. In a pivotal study in postmenopausal osteoporosis, oral ibandronate, administered daily or with a between-dose interval of >2 months, demonstrated robust antifracture efficacy and an overall incidence of upper GI adverse events similar to placebo, even in patients at increased risk of such events. This and other clinical studies conducted in postmenopausal women demonstrate that oral ibandronate has an excellent upper GI safety profile.

Abstract
The barium esophagram is a valuable diagnostic test for evaluating structural and functional abnormalities of the esophagus. The study is usually performed as a multiphasic examination that includes upright double-contrast views with a high-density barium suspension, prone single-contrast views with a low-density barium suspension, and, not infrequently, mucosal-relief views with either density of barium suspension. The double-contrast phase optimizes the ability to detect inflammatory or neoplastic diseases, whereas the single-contrast phase optimizes the ability to detect hiatal hernias and lower esophageal rings or strictures. Fluoroscopic examination of the esophagus is also important for assessing motility disorders such as achalasia and diffuse esophageal spasm. This article is a review of gastroesophageal reflux disease, other types of esophagitis, benign and malignant esophageal tumors, varices, lower esophageal rings, diverticula, and esophageal motility disorders, all of which can be diagnosed with the aid of esophagography.

Abstract
PURPOSE To review and discuss the clinical evaluation and therapeutic options for a postmenopausal woman with osteoporosis. DATA SOURCES Review of scientific literature, practice guidelines, and a case study. CONCLUSIONS To prevent and treat postmenopausal osteoporosis, women should be encouraged to perform weight-bearing exercise, to not smoke, and to optimize calcium and vitamin D intake through diet and supplements. Drug regimens are effective and well tolerated in postmenopausal women with osteoporosis. IMPLICATIONS FOR PRACTICE Drugs currently approved by the U.S. Food and Drug Administration for the treatment of postmenopausal osteoporosis include the bisphosphonates risedronate and alendronate; the selective estrogen receptor modulator, raloxifene; and intranasal calcitonin-salmon spray. Bisphosphonates have demonstrated the most impressive fracture risk reduction in prospective clinical trials of women with postmenopausal osteoporosis. Risedronate has consistently demonstrated significant reductions in vertebral fracture risk at 1 year and in vertebral and nonvertebral fracture risk at 3 years. Alendronate has demonstrated significant reductions in vertebral and nonvertebral fracture risk after 3 years.

Abstract
The prevalence of osteoporosis in all US postmenopausal women is 17%, and it is as high as 30% in women older than 65. All postmenopausal women should be encouraged to have adequate daily calcium and vitamin D intake, to exercise regularly, and to avoid tobacco and excessive alcohol use. Although the clinical impact and cost-effectiveness of osteoporosis screening tools remain to be established, a rational approach based on current evidence involves using National Osteoporosis Foundation guidelines, Simple Calculated Osteoporosis Risk Estimation, or Osteoporosis Risk Assessment Instrument clinical decision rules to decide when a postmenopausal woman should undergo further evaluation.

Abstract
Benign esophageal strictures are a leading cause of dysphagia. Therefore, radiologists have an important role in detecting esophageal strictures and determining their cause. The most common cause of strictures in the distal esophagus is gastroesophageal reflux disease. Reflux-induced ("peptic") strictures may be associated with sacculations, fixed transverse folds, or esophageal intramural pseudodiverticula. In addition, scleroderma, nasogastric intubation, Zollinger-Ellison syndrome, and alkaline reflux esophagitis may be associated with stricture formation in the distal esophagus. Upper and midesophageal strictures may be caused by Barrett esophagus, mediastinal irradiation, ingestion of drugs or caustic substances, congenital esophageal stenosis, skin diseases, or esophageal intramural pseudodiverticulosis. Other unusual causes of esophageal stricture formation include Crohn disease, Candida esophagitis, graft-versus-host disease, eosinophilic esophagitis, Behçet disease, endoscopic sclerotherapy for esophageal varices, and glutaraldehyde contamination at endoscopy. Esophageal strictures are best evaluated with biphasic esophagography that includes both single- and double-contrast spot images. When esophageal strictures are detected at barium examination, the underlying cause can often be determined with a pattern approach that takes into account the clinical history, the appearance and location of the strictures, and the presence of other associated radiographic findings.

Abstract
BACKGROUND Drug-induced or "pill-induced" esophagitis may be secondary to the prolonged contact of the drug with the esophageal mucosa or secondary to the drug ability to alter the local conditions. The alendronate sodium, a bone resorption inhibitor used in the treatment and prevention of osteoporosis, has been cited, recently, as one of the causes of adverse upper gastrointestinal tract injury. AIM To describe the clinical, endoscopic and histopathological features of patients with ulcerative esophagitis associated with alendronate sodium. PATIENTS Four women and one man with osteoporosis were treated with alendronate sodium and submitted to endoscopy followed esophageal biopsy. RESULTS The age range of the patients was from 64 to 84 years old. The patients showed dyspeptic symptoms after taking alendronate sodium during a period of 2-12 months. At endoscopic evaluation, the mucosa was friable, with erosion and/or ulceration covered by fibrin in the distal esophagus. The pathological examination of the esophageal biopsies revealed ulcerative esophagitis characterized by necrofibrinpurulent material, granulation tissue, and yellow refractile polarizable crystal. The patients' symptoms resolved after stopping alendronate sodium use. CONCLUSIONS The esophagus injuries associated with alendronate sodium are not frequent and seem to be associated with the incorrect use of medication. The endoscopists and pathologists should be alert to the possibility of alendronate sodium therapy in cases of diagnosis of ulcerative esophagitis in ancient patients, particularly in women. The recognition of this condition would improve the patient care.

Abstract
In the US, the major pharmacotherapeutic approaches for the prevention or treatment of osteoporosis in women are estrogen-based hormone replacement therapy, selective estrogen receptor modulators, salmon calcitonin, bisphosphonates, calcium, and vitamin D. All of these treatments are beneficial in increasing bone mineral density and reducing fractures in patients with osteoporosis. However, each of the therapies possesses a unique mechanism of action and other potential benefits and side effects. Estrogen replacement therapy may lower the risk of cardiovascular disease, but it increases the risk of venous thromboembolism (VTE) and may increase the risk of breast cancer. Unopposed estrogen therapy is associated with increased risk for endometrial cancer, but the addition of progestins virtually eliminates this adverse event. The selective estrogen receptor modulator raloxifene is associated with positive cardiovascular effects and demonstrates a protective effect against some types of breast cancer. Like estrogen, raloxifene increases the risk of VTE. Salmon calcitonin has a strong analgesic effect and is not associated with any serious long-term adverse events, but some individuals may not be able to tolerate the nasal formulation. Bisphosphonates are associated with serious upper GI effects. The concomitant administration of calcium and vitamin D in all patients being treated for osteoporosis is generally recommended.Selecting optimal treatment relies on an individualized risk–benefit analysis that takes into account the patient's medical history, concomitant diseases, current medications, general physical and mental well being, and personal feelings about the various therapies. Careful consideration of the various treatment options may lead to improved compliance and more effective management of osteoporosis.

Abstract
Oral bisphosphonates are effective for osteoporosis and other hyperresorptive bone disorders. Although well-tolerated in efficacy trials, some oral aminobisphosphonates have been associated with upper gastrointestinal intolerance and injury in postmarketing experience. Clinical trials often underestimate the rate of adverse events in clinical practice, and ethics prohibit direct evaluation of toxicity in high-risk patients. Accordingly, animal models and endoscopy studies of oral bisphosphonates provide valuable insight. It is unclear whether variation in ulcerogenic potential reflects differences in dosing, formulation or chemical structure. Furthermore, the clinical relevance of endoscopic lesions is uncertain. Ongoing postmarketing review will determine whether differences in endoscopic damage predict tolerability and safety in clinical practice. However, physicians and patients should consider risk factors for oesophageal injury when initiating therapy.

Abstract
OBJECTIVE This manuscript identifies characteristics that put people with rheumatoid arthritis (RA) at high risk for osteoporosis or gastrointestinal (GI) disturbances. The manuscript then reviews therapies available for osteoporosis in the United States and makes recommendations about choosing therapies that minimize GI adverse effects in RA patients at high risk for such events. DATA SOURCES References identified through MEDLINE, abstracts, and prescribing information for individual drugs. DATA EXTRACTION Characteristics that predispose patients to osteoporosis and GI problems were identified. Data on individual osteoporosis therapies were assessed by risk-benefit analysis and appropriateness for use in patients at risk for GI disturbances. DATA SYNTHESIS High risk of osteoporosis in people with RA is caused by disease activity, medication effects, physical inactivity, and standard risk factors such as postmenopausal status and increased age. Patients with RA are frequently at high GI risk if they are receiving nonsteroidal anti-inflammatory drugs or corticosteroids. Because of the high potential for erosive esophagitis and other upper GI disorders with alendronate, caution is warranted in prescribing alendronate to RA patients with high GI risk. In such patients, estrogen replacement therapy, selective estrogen receptor modulators, or calcitonin should be considered for treatment, and either estrogen replacement therapy or selective estrogen receptor modulators should be considered for osteoporosis prevention. CONCLUSIONS Assessment of GI risk is important in patients with RA and osteoporosis. Risk factors should be considered when choosing osteoporosis therapies.

Abstract
Nonsteroidal anti-inflammatory drugs (NSAIDs) are widely prescribed in the United States to treat pain and reduce inflammation from chronic inflammatory disorders such as rheumatoid arthritis and osteoarthritis. Approximately 40% of older Americans take NSAIDs. Chronic NSAID use carries a risk of peptic ulcer and other gastrointestinal disturbances. This article reviews the diagnosis of medication-induced ulcers based on clinical presentation, laboratory tests, and endoscopic findings to assist the clinician in early diagnosis and appropriate therapy. Risk factors for NSAID-induced ulcers include old age, poor medical status, prior ulcer, alcoholism, smoking, high NSAID dosage, prolonged NSAID use, and concomitant use of other drugs that are gastric irritants, such as alendronate, a bone resorption inhibitor prescribed for osteoporosis. Appropriate treatment options for patients with medication-induced ulcers include dosage reduction, medication substitution, medication withdrawal, antiulcer therapy, and discontinuation of other gastrotoxic drugs.

Abstract
Nine hundred seventy-nine cases of pill esophagitis due to nearly 100 different medications are reviewed. Pill-induced injuries occur when caustic medicinal pills dissolve in the esophagus rather than passing rapidly into the stomach as intended. Most patients suffer only self-limited pain, but esophageal hemorrhage, stricture, and perforation may occur, and fatal injuries have been reported. The incidence of this iatrogenic injury can be reduced but not eliminated by emphasizing the importance of taking pills while upright and with plenty of fluids.

Abstract
A treatment against osteoporosis can be considered efficacious only when its beneficial effects on bone remodeling, bone mass, and osteoporotic fracture incidence are proven. As for any treatment, proven efficacy must be combined with proven safety. This review analyzes published data on efficacy and safety of alendronate, clodronate and etidronate, the bisphosphonates currently marketed in Italy for osteoporosis treatment. Different studies have shown that alendronate, clodronate and etidronate reduce bone turnover, and increase bone mineral density in postmenopausal osteoporotic patients. Prospective, double blind, multicenter studies reported a reduction in osteoporotic fracture incidence for alendronate and etidronate. Fracture incidence reduction by clodronate, on the other hand, was shown only in an open label study. Finally, a reduction in fracture incidence by etidronate was shown in a large retrospective postmarketing study. Postmarketing surveillance evidenced that osteomalacia, a suspected side effect of etidronate treatment, does not occur at the currently used dose regimens. Postmarketing surveillance of alendronate has recently raised some concern regarding possible severe esophageal damage during alendronate treatment, especially when the drug is not taken according to the manufacturer's instructions.
